"There are regular shotguns, there are competition shotguns, and then there's this. Using a very clever quadruple-tube system, designed to automatically rotate to the next filled tube when emptied, and to the next empty tube when reloaded, the XM2XI, or X-Shotgun, can carry a truly ridiculous 26 rounds of ammunition before a reload is necessary, without adding any extra steps or complicated systems in the process. Simply load it like you would any other shotgun with an internal tube (it might take a while to fully load it), and you're good to go. Simple, yet extremely capable, just as a shotgun should be." |

The XM2XI "X-Shotgun" (also called XM2XI, X-Shotgun, or simply XM2) is a 12 gauge shotgun.
Obtaining this weapon
This weapon is referred to as a Specs-docs only weapon. It cannot be normally found in the Mazes, and will only be available after completing the following requirements:
- Turn in the following to the Proving Grounds engineer, at the Calfair Sector workshop:
- Specs docs: #XR329 - Prototype shotgun magazine blueprints (Helical, 25-round capacity)
- A Benelli M2 Super 90, which will be used for conversion into this weapon.
- 500
Upon completing the requirements listed above, the engineer will offer a brand new X-Shotgun in exchange. For this reason, this weapon is Rarity 7 (Unique).
Please note that the Proving Grounds engineer is only available during the day shift (between 8 AM and 8 PM).
Maze Customs
This weapon can receive the following minor customization services:
- X-Shotgun Mark 2
X-Shotgun Mark 2
Naturally, astute minds have noticed that this weapon system is lacking accessory mounting points and that it wouldn't be a "real" competition shotgun if you didn't have the opportunity to stick additional accessories on it. The X-Shotgun Mark 2 aims at answering these needs. It is the same weapon, but with a threaded barrel and three additional accessory rails; a top rail for optics, and two side rails for your lights and lasers. It can be thought of as the X-Shotgun alternative to the M2 Super 90 Enhanced, as it brings in the same modifications.
Modifications:
- Muzzle: Becomes Standard devices.
- Optics: Becomes NATO Short mount.
- Lights: Becomes 2x Short interface.
Note: You can also obtain an XM2XI "X-Shotgun" Mark 2 directly by converting an M2 Super 90 Enhanced.
